I started by thinking about what kind of toys pets from shelters might like. You know, something comforting and fun. I figured they’ve been through a lot, so a nice, new toy might make them happy.

Then, I gathered some stuff. I used some old t-shirts because they’re soft, and I had a bunch lying around. I also grabbed some stuffing from an old pillow that I didn’t use anymore. I made sure everything was clean, of course.
Next, I cut the t-shirts into strips. This was kind of a hassle, but it was okay. I tied the strips together to make a big, fluffy ball. I made sure to tie them really tight so the dogs or cats couldn’t pull them apart easily. I don’t want them choking on anything.
- First, I tied a few strips together in the middle to make a strong base.
- Then, I kept adding more strips, tying them around the base until it looked like a ball.
- Finally, I stuffed some of the pillow stuffing in between the strips to make it even softer.
I tested it out with my own dog first, and he seemed to like it! He chased it around and chewed on it a bit, and it held up pretty well. I was happy to see him having fun.
